What Is Emotional Distress Law?

Beyond physical injuries, accidents can cause lasting emotional injuries that affect your mental health. In a personal injury lawsuit, injury victims can sue for emotional distress damages caused by the accident.

You can prove emotional distress damages in a personal injury lawsuit with testimony from medical experts or mental health providers. Many states have a limit on how much you can recover for emotional distress injuries.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Personal Injury Lawyer To Sue for Emotional Distress?

Many injury victims do not recognize their emotional injuries after an accident. However, if your accident and injuries have also left you struggling with your mental health, it may be possible to seek compensation for emotional distress. Some signs of emotional distress linked to your accident can include:

  • Anxiety
  • Difficulty sleeping
  • Depression
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D)
  • Substance abuse

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Personal Injury Lawyer?

If you don’t hire a personal injury lawyer, you might struggle to get fair compensation for your injuries. Without legal guidance, you could miss important deadlines to file a lawsuit, fail to gather the right evidence, or be taken advantage of by insurance companies. This might result in accepting a settlement offer that is less than what you need to cover medical bills, lost wages, and other expenses. A lawyer helps protect your rights, builds a strong case, and negotiates on your behalf, increasing your chances of getting the most possible compensation.

What Are the Top Questions When Choosing a Personal Injury Lawyer in Montrose?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able that a lawyer has the experience and ability to manage your case well. Most personal injury lawyers offer free consultations that allow you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:

  • What experience do you have in handling personal injury cases?
  • Have you previously represented clients with similar types of accidents or injuries to mine?
  • How long have you been practicing in California?
  • What is your success rate in winning settlements or verdicts for your clients in personal injury cases?
  • How will you assess the strength of my case and determine its value?
  • Do you have a network of experts, such as accident reconstruction specialists or medical professionals, who can support my case if needed? What is your approach to negotiating with insurance companies?
  • What percentage of my compensation will you take in fees?
